What Is a Modern Adoption?

Modern Adoption gives you choices.

You choose your baby’s parents.

You choose how much contact you want.

You choose what happens at the hospital.

  • In an open adoption, a birth mother can choose the parents she wants to raise her child and can even meet them before the birth. The birth mother and the adoptive family will agree on the amount of communication they want going forward. For some families, this looks like celebrating birthdays together; for others, it can look like just checking in with the occasional update via text.
  • Semi-closed adoptions allow the birth mother and the adoptive family to communicate through a third party, but all identifying information remains confidential.
  • For women who do not want contact with the adoptive family, closed adoption might be the best choice. The contact information for all parties will remain sealed and confidential.
